Purity and Innocence in Scripture

In Scripture, the color white is often associated with purity and innocence, as evidenced by the description of Jesus' garments in Revelation 19:11-14, where His white robes symbolize His sinless nature.

As you explore further into the Bible, you'll discover that white is also linked to moral cleanliness and righteousness.

In Psalm 51:7, David prays to be washed clean, asking God to 'purify me with hyssop, that I may be clean; wash me, and I'll be whiter than snow.' This verse highlights the connection between white and spiritual purity.

Symbolism of White in Revelation

As you turn to the book of Revelation, you'll find that white continues to symbolize spiritual purity, with its significance expanding to encompass a broader apocalyptic context. In this book, white is associated with those who've been made righteous through their faith in God, and who'll ultimately be spared from His wrath during the End times prophecy.

White is used symbolically in Revelation in four key ways:

  1. White robes: Represent the righteous deeds of believers, who'll be clothed in white at the resurrection (Revelation 3:4-5, 19:8).
  2. White throne: Symbolizes God's judgment and authority, from which He'll judge all nations (Revelation 20:11-15).
  3. White horse: Represents Christ's triumphant return, when He'll conquer evil and establish His reign (Revelation 19:11-16).
  4. White stone: Signifies the gift of eternal life, which will be granted to those who overcome the challenges of the End times (Revelation 2:17).

In Revelation, white is a powerful symbol of God's redemption and ultimate victory over evil. As you reflect on the symbolism of white in your dreams, consider how it may be connected to your own spiritual journey and relationship with God.

Spiritual Cleansing and Forgiveness

When you dream of the color white, it may signal a deep-seated desire for spiritual cleansing and forgiveness, reflecting your inner need to purge yourself of guilt, shame, or emotional baggage.

This desire for purification is rooted in your longing for inner peace and a fresh start. The Bible says, 'Though your sins are like scarlet, they'll be as white as snow' (Isaiah 1:18).

This promise of redemption is echoed in your dream, reminding you that you can leave your past mistakes behind and start anew.
